Abstract
Diacylglycerol-amino acid conjugates constitute a novel class of biocompatible surfactants being of great interest both from academic and industrial viewpoints. In this paper, the aqueous phase behaviour of 1,2-di-lauroyl-rac-glycero-3-(Nα-acetyl-l-arginine) (indicated as 1212RAc) is investigated by a number of experimental approaches.The phase diagram is dominated by three monophasic regions; an isotropic solution, and two lamellar phases separated by a birefringent biphasic region.
